【问题标题】:Buildozer APK crash "Consumer closed input channel or an error occurred. events=0x9"Buildozer APK 崩溃“消费者关闭输入通道或发生错误。事件 = 0x9”
【发布时间】:2020-05-29 15:44:16
【问题描述】:

我已经使用 buildozer 构建了我的第一个 apk,没有出现错误,但现在它在 android 上崩溃了。 我在日志中发现“消费者关闭输入通道或发生错误。事件 = 0x9”但我不知道为什么会出现此错误: 这里是are the logslogs,这里是is buildozer.specspec

感谢您的帮助!

【问题讨论】:

  • 发布完整的 logcat 输出
  • 我原始消息中的日志是 logcat 输出
  • 不确定是什么原因造成的,但实际错误是couldn't find "libpython3.7m.so"。它也找不到“3.6”或“3.5”。
  • 谢谢,我没有看到他。我在github.com/kivy/buildozer/issues/1133 开了一个问题

标签: kivy apk buildozer


【解决方案1】:

我遇到了您提到的错误,但事实证明我遇到了不同的问题。 “Consumer closed...”消息只是其他问题的信号。

现在,正如 John Anderson 已经说过的,您遇到的实际问题是 Python 在您的应用程序启动时永远不会加载。在 GitHub 上,你说你已经安装了 Python 3.7,所以不知道为什么,它在你的情况下没有加载。

我遇到了同样的错误,但安装了 Python 3.8,因此它可以加载并且一切正常。

【讨论】:

    猜你喜欢
    • 2012-01-30
    • 2011-09-04
    • 2012-03-04
    • 1970-01-01
    • 2012-10-17
    • 1970-01-01
    • 2020-03-26
    相关资源
    最近更新 更多